#3b9a95 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b9a95 is composed of 23.1% red, 60.4%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.2%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 176.8 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 41.8%. #3b9a95 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#00352b.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#3b9a95 color description : Dark moderate cyan.

#3b9a95 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3b9a95 has RGB values of R:59, G:154,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 3906197.

Hex triplet 3b9a95 #3b9a95
RGB Decimal 59, 154, 149 rgb(59,154,149)
RGB Percent 23.1, 60.4, 58.4 rgb(23.1%,60.4%,58.4%)
CMYK 62, 0, 3, 40
HSL 176.8°, 44.6, 41.8 hsl(176.8,44.6%,41.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 176.8°, 61.7, 60.4
Web Safe 339999 #339999
CIE-LAB 58.235, -28.746, -5.671
XYZ 18.782, 26.209, 32.501
xyY 0.242, 0.338, 26.209
CIE-LCH 58.235, 29.3, 191.159
CIE-LUV 58.235, -38.126, -4.01
Hunter-Lab 51.195, -24.104, -1.804
Binary 00111011, 10011010, 10010101

Shades and Tints of #3b9a95

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050c0c is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b9a95

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#647170 is the less saturated color, while #02d3c8 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#3b9a95 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#7d7d7d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#708382 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#949192 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#988ea0 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#4c9da8 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#739493 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#76929c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#469ba1 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
